Revolutionizing Multi-Agent Systems: The DMoA Approach
Differentiable Mixture-of-Agents (DMoA) redefines multi-agent frameworks by enabling dynamic adaptability in complex tasks, achieving SOTA results.
Recent advances in Large Language Models have paved the way for innovative developments in multi-agent systems. However, one major drawback has been the rigidity of their communication structures. Enter Differentiable Mixture-of-Agents (DMoA), a groundbreaking framework that introduces elasticity and adaptability into agent collaboration, significantly enhancing the potential for complex reasoning tasks.
DMoA's Dynamic Innovation
The paper's key contribution is the introduction of a self-evolving, multi-agent framework that dynamically routes and activates agents during inference. By moving away from static workflows, DMoA can simulate various communication topologies at each reasoning step. This adaptability is important for addressing the continuously evolving demands of complex tasks.
How does it achieve this flexibility? DMoA uses a differentiable, context-aware routing mechanism. This leverages recurrent structures to integrate historical and contextual information over time, resulting in sparse and efficient agent activations. Predictive entropy is used as self-supervised signals to optimize this routing, allowing the system to adapt efficiently at test-time without relying on external annotations.
Performance and Efficiency
What's the outcome of such an innovative approach? Extensive experiments across nine benchmarks indicate that DMoA not only achieves state-of-the-art performance but also exhibits commendable efficiency, robustness, and ensembling capabilities. The ablation study reveals that the adaptive routing mechanism is a significant factor in the system's performance gains.
This builds on prior work from the domain, yet pushes boundaries by introducing a level of flexibility previously unseen. In practical terms, this could mean faster and more accurate responses from AI systems in dynamic environments such as autonomous vehicles or real-time translation services.
Why It Matters
Why should the tech community take note of DMoA? The ability to adapt on-the-fly to changing environments isn't just a technical improvement, it has real-world implications for the deployment of AI systems in unpredictable settings. One might wonder if this marks the beginning of more adaptable AI frameworks becoming the norm rather than the exception.
What's missing, however, is a comprehensive analysis of the energy efficiency of such adaptable systems. As we push towards more complex AI frameworks, sustainability will become an increasingly pressing issue.
Code and data are available at the project repository, making this work not just a theoretical advancement but a practical tool for researchers and developers. The question remains: how quickly will this model be adopted in real-world applications, and what barriers might it face in scaling?
Get AI news in your inbox
Daily digest of what matters in AI.